It will automatically come under step ten (D8 or D10) when it goes to payroll for F&F. The authority to waive off the notice period varies from company to company. In some companies, only HR has the authority, while in others it's HR and the Personnel Head. In my company, if HR approves the waiver of the notice period, no one can challenge it. If an employee wants to waive off his notice pay, we have to take it in written form so that in the future we don't have any problems. We cannot show it in the F & F form. In most organizations, the Head of HR or HR Manager will approve it.

Friends, processes are specific to an organization. I request everyone not to simply cut, copy, and paste the processes of one organization to another. Each organization decides its own systems and processes based on the business environment, objectives, and challenges.
